Chattering in Machining: Causes, Effects, and Solutions

The self-excited vibration known as chattering leads to poor machining outcomes through rough finishes, accelerated tool wear, and reduced efficiency. Weak rigidity combined with improper tools and suboptimal parameters alongside unstable workpieces generates chattering. Detection spans visual, auditory, and sensor-based methods cnc milling cutters
. The key to understanding chatter preventing issues lies in strengthening rigidity alongside choosing the best tools and tuning parameters while damping vibrations both of which lead to improved precision and productivity.
